The Difficulty of Authentic Leadership

Authentic leadership is challenging primarily for the following reasons:

1.???? Authentic leadership demands a level of integrity and ethical conduct that goes beyond mere compliance with rules and regulations. Leaders must consistently prioritize doing what is right, even when it may not be in their immediate self-interest. This commitment to ethical behavior can be difficult to uphold in environments where success is often measured by individual achievements or material gains, leading some to compromise their values for personal gain.

2.???? Authentic leadership requires leaders to operate without personal or hidden agendas. Leaders must act with transparency, sincerity, and humility, placing the needs of the greater good above their own ego or ambition. In a culture that often glorifies individual success and encourages self-promotion, this level of selflessness can be challenging to maintain, and even harder for others to understand.

3.???? Authentic leaders must often challenge the status quo to advocate for positive change, even if it means facing resistance or backlash. This willingness to disrupt the norm and push for progress can be met with opposition from those who are invested in maintaining the status quo or preserving their own power and privilege. Unfortunately, the opposition can also come from senior leaders.

4.???? Authentic leaders don't compromise.? Today’s leaders often struggle with pressure to success at all costs. Unfortunately, many give in to it. This is one of the reasons that 85% of workers are unhappy in their work environment. Getting to the next level or protecting spheres of influence often become more important than having team members’ backs. Authentic leaders stand on what they know, while being strategic on how issues are addressed.

Why Authentic Leadership is Not Popular

Authentic leadership has been criticized for being idealistic, impractical, and less effective. The traits and values inherent in authentic leadership ( i.e. integrity, honesty, and a commitment to serving others) have been deemed as weaknesses rather than strengths, leading some leaders to shy away from embracing this leadership posture.?

The problem with this analysis is that it's one-sided.? It’s generally assessed from the perspective of individuals whose values are more aligned with self-interest rather than for the good of those they lead or by individuals who don’t fully understand the foundation of authenticity.
